cmattoon/aws-ssm

View on GitHub
aws-ssm/templates/secret.yaml

Summary

Maintainability
Test Coverage
 {{ if and (ne .Values.aws.secret_key "") (ne .Values.aws.access_key "") -}}
---
apiVersion: v1
kind: Secret
metadata:
  name: aws-ssm-credentials
  labels:
    app.kubernetes.io/name: {{ template "ssm.name" . }}
    app.kubernetes.io/managed-by: {{ .Release.Service }}
    app.kubernetes.io/instance: {{ .Release.Name }}
    app.kubernetes.io/version: {{ .Chart.AppVersion }}
    helm.sh/chart: {{ .Chart.Name }}-{{ .Chart.Version | replace "+" "_" }}
type: Opaque
data:
  AWS_ACCESS_KEY: "{{ .Values.aws.access_key | b64enc }}"
  AWS_SECRET_KEY: "{{ .Values.aws.secret_key | b64enc }}"
{{ end -}}